Associate Medical Assistant - UROLOGY

The Associate Medical Assistant (MA I) works unders the delegation of a licensed practioner to perform duties as directed to assist in providing basic patient care to assigned patients. Basic patient care needs will be met though both administrative and clinical duties. An Associate Medical Assistant (MA I) is expected to perform in accordance with established policies, procedures, and regulations.
